  • Tool: For highly sensitive types like me, room noise can be a real distraction (and quite distressing if you're trying to carry on a conversation!). I was delighted to find the SoundPrint app via The New Yorker's feature, Yelp for Noise.

    After you run a 15-second room noise detection, you can upload the data to share with other SoundPrinters. And feel redeemed knowing you're not crazy if the room level reads LOUD 🤪
